Como tirar um instantâneo do sistema de arquivos no linux (arquivos, apenas seus tamanhos, não seus dados)

3

Precisamos tirar uma foto do seu servidor linux. Não queremos fazer o backup dos dados, apenas um instantâneo que podemos comparar com as alterações.

    
por gAMBOOKa 19.05.2010 / 09:50

3 respostas

4
find / -ls > fileinfo.txt

Mas dê uma olhada no tripwire e aide, já que isso parece ser o que você está buscando. Observe também que o rpm pode verificar arquivos contra checksums e para distribuições baseadas no debian há debsums.

    
por 19.05.2010 / 11:19
2

Eu recomendaria verificar se há md5 somas de arquivos, e não apenas o tamanho do arquivo. no entanto:

find / -printf "%h/%f %s\n" > /some/path/filesize geraria uma lista de arquivos e seus tamanhos.

você também pode fazer find / | xargs md5sum 2> /dev/null 1> /some/path/file-md5s para gerar uma lista de nomes de arquivos e suas somas md5.

    
por 19.05.2010 / 10:08
0

use

du <filesystem mount point>

ele deve fornecer tamanho e arquivo no local completo

    
por 19.05.2010 / 10:58